Hi all,
In preparing for a lush2 release I want to go
through all the packages and make sure they work,
at least on linux. I know that most won't work right
now because there have been lots of changes in the
language. But which ones need updating and which
ones do we want to get rid of because they are
obsolete?
Below is the current list of package directories and
a little note from me next to it:
"ok" means works on linux afaik,
"dump" means I think it's not worth keeping,
"upd" means it needs updating, and
"?" means probably does not work and I am not sure
what to do with it.
alsa ?
audio ok
audiofile ?
blas ok (*)
cblas dump
devices ?
ffmpeg upd
fftw upd
gblearn2 ?
gblearning ?
gnuplot ok
gsl ?
inventor upd
jpeg upd
lapack ok (*)
libnum ok
libsvm upd
mpi ?
music ?
opencv dump
opencv2 ok
opengl upd
optim ok
sdl upd
sdlgames upd
sn28 upd
svm upd
torch dump
video upd
video4linux upd
(*) These are not the same packages as in lush1, I
started rewriting those.
Yann, please fill in the ?s and let me know if you
want to change anything else. I removed the HTK package
a while ago as it looks like that software is now
closed source and must be purchased.
